Perspectives

Both analyses agree the post uses emotive, heroic language about Imran Khan, but they differ on its implications: the critical perspective sees this as a manipulation cue, while the supportive perspective views the lack of calls to action and varied wording as signs of spontaneous expression. Weighing the concrete observations, the emotional framing suggests some bias, yet the absence of coordinated messaging and explicit pressure reduces the likelihood of a coordinated propaganda effort, leading to a moderate manipulation rating.

Key Points

  • The post’s language is overtly heroic (e.g., "righteous never falter", "relentless march of justice and truth"), which can create an us‑vs‑them narrative and is a known emotional‑appeal tactic.
  • No direct calls to action, donation requests, or uniform phrasing across accounts are present, indicating the post may be an individual’s spontaneous reaction.
  • The hashtag #ImranKhanHealthRedAlert aligns with a contemporaneous health rumor, suggesting timing‑driven posting rather than pre‑planned coordination.
  • Both perspectives provide factual observations; the critical view emphasizes bias, while the supportive view emphasizes lack of coordination, resulting in a balanced, moderate manipulation assessment.

Analysis Factors

Confidence
False Dilemmas 2/5
It suggests only two options: either stand with Khan’s “justice” or be part of the conspiracy, presenting a false dichotomy.
Us vs. Them Dynamic 3/5
The phrase “righteous never falter” creates an us‑vs‑them dynamic, positioning Khan’s supporters as morally superior to opponents.
Simplistic Narratives 3/5
The message frames the situation in binary terms—Khan is just, his opponents are conspirators—simplifying a complex political landscape.
Timing Coincidence 3/5
The post appeared shortly after a rumor about Imran Khan’s health spread on X/Twitter, linking it temporally to that event, which suggests a moderate timing coincidence (score 3).
Historical Parallels 2/5
The language resembles classic hero‑cult propaganda (e.g., “righteous never falter”), yet it does not directly copy any documented state‑run disinformation campaigns (score 2).
Financial/Political Gain 2/5
The author’s account shows no financial ties, but the message benefits Imran Khan’s political image, indicating a vague political beneficiary without clear monetary gain (score 2).
Bandwagon Effect 2/5
The tweet hints that “every blow becomes fuel,” implying a growing movement, but it does not explicitly claim that everyone is already supporting the view.
Rapid Behavior Shifts 1/5
No surge in activity or pressure to change opinions was detected; the hashtag’s reach remained modest, indicating no rapid shift pressure (score 1).
Phrase Repetition 2/5
While other users employed the same hashtag, their wording differs; there is no evidence of a coordinated script or identical messaging across outlets (score 2).
Logical Fallacies 3/5
The statement employs an appeal to emotion (pathos) by equating attacks on Khan with “fuel for justice,” which is a non‑sequitur logical fallacy.
Authority Overload 1/5
No experts, officials, or credible sources are cited to substantiate the claims; the post relies solely on emotive language.
Cherry-Picked Data 1/5
The content does not present data at all, so no selective statistics are used.
Framing Techniques 4/5
Words like “relentless march,” “righteous,” and “justice” frame Khan positively while casting opponents as conspiratorial, biasing the reader’s perception.
Suppression of Dissent 1/5
There is no mention of critics or dissenting voices, nor are they labeled negatively; the focus stays on praise.
Context Omission 4/5
The tweet omits any context about the health rumors, legal challenges, or political controversies surrounding Khan, leaving readers without crucial facts.
Novelty Overuse 2/5
The content makes no unprecedented or shocking claims; it repeats familiar praise without presenting new information.
Emotional Repetition 3/5
The words “righteous,” “justice,” and “truth” are repeated, reinforcing a consistent emotional theme throughout the short message.
Manufactured Outrage 2/5
The tweet does not express outrage; it is a positive affirmation of Imran Khan’s stance, lacking any angry or accusatory tone.
Urgent Action Demands 2/5
There is no explicit call to immediate action; the post simply declares support without urging readers to do anything right now.
Emotional Triggers 4/5
The tweet uses emotionally charged phrasing such as “relentless march of justice and truth” and portrays Imran Khan as a heroic figure, aiming to evoke admiration and solidarity.
